so for a long time scientists have been

trying to figure out how plants start

the process of turning sunlight into

sugar through photosynthesis but now

some researchers have finally decoded

those tricky signals that plants send to

themselves

for many years botanists have known that

the nucleus in a plant cell is like the

boss sending out commands to other parts

of the cell it does so by creating

proteins that tell the other parts what

to do and if those proteins aren't there

the plant won't be able to grow or turn

green but there are hundreds of

different proteins in the nucleus

and figuring out which ones tell the

plant to start photosynthesis has been a

huge challenge it's been like trying to

find a needle in a haystack

but now the botany Professor Ming chin

and his team managed to find four of

those proteins and documented the entire

process in simple words Chen and his

team found four new proteins that help

plants start the process of

photosynthesis which turns sunlight into

energy for growth

these proteins are part of a complex

process that happens in two different

rooms in the cell and they help the

different parts of the plant talk to

each other so they can work together to

make energy

Chen Compares this process to a symphony

where the proteins in the nucleus act as

the conductors Who start the music these

conductors are called photoreceptors

which implies that they respond to light

and activate genes that kick off

photosynthesis

however they need to communicate with

other parts of the cell which are far

away like musicians playing in different

rooms

this is where the four newly discovered

proteins come in they help the

conductors send messages to the other

parts of the cell

is because the chloroplasts which are

plant cell parts responsible for

photosynthesis and mitochondria that

generate chemical energy in human cells

have some similarities both are

important for generating energy for

growth and they also contain genetic

material

scientists have been studying internal

communication processes inside the cell

they found out that when something goes

wrong with the little organs inside a

cell called organelles they will send a

message to the nucleus which acts as the

headquarters of the cell

foreign

however we don't know much about how the

nucleus sends messages back to the

organelles Chen thinks that the way the

nucleus communicates with the organelles

in plants is similar to how it works in

Animals by studying how the nucleus

communicates with the chloroplasts we

can learn how it also controls the

mitochondrial genes dysfunction of these

genes may lead to dangerous diseases

like cancer so we could learn to control

these processes and thus maybe find ways

to reverse cancer processes
